Osano

  • The published visitor ceilings are low, with the paid self-serve tier stopping around 30,000 monthly visitors, so any consumer facing site with real traffic leaves published pricing immediately and negotiates a quote with no public anchor.
  • The no fines guarantee is bounded and conditional on configuring the product as instructed, so it is a marketing differentiator with an indemnity cap rather than the insurance policy the name suggests, and the limits should be read before it influences a decision.
  • Everything beyond consent, including subject rights automation, data mapping and vendor monitoring, is enterprise quoted, so the transparent pricing that attracts buyers covers only the cheapest part of the platform.
  • Tag blocking depends on tags being loaded through the mechanisms Osano can intercept, and marketing teams that inject scripts directly into templates or through server side tagging routinely leak trackers past the banner without anyone noticing.
  • It is a privacy platform rather than a security compliance one, so organisations that also need SOC 2 or ISO 27001 evidence collection run it alongside a separate tool and duplicate parts of the vendor and asset inventory.

Osano: Can it handle US state privacy laws as well as GDPR?

Yes, with region aware rule sets covering GDPR, ePrivacy and the US state regimes, so an EU visitor sees an opt-in banner and a US visitor sees the applicable opt-out.

Osano: Does Osano do subject access requests?

Yes, but in the enterprise tier rather than the published plans, and it is quoted separately from consent.
